Sunflower 2754 A — an ultra-early and low-growing sunflower variety with a vegetation period of about 80 days, allowing for harvest in a short time. Plant height ranges from 145 to 170 cm, facilitating care and harvest. The variety is highly resistant to five races of downy mildew (A–E), significantly reducing the risk of crop loss. Recommended for cultivation in all agricultural zones, especially in northern regions with a frost-free period of at least 110 days. Plants withstand frosts down to -7°C, and the latest sowing date is July 20. Seeds are treated with a complex of fungicides, including thiophanate-methyl, thiabendazole, and metalaxyl-M, providing protection against diseases and improving germination.
Hybrid Sunflower 2754 A has high yield potential — from 20 to 30 centners per hectare under standard cultivation practices.
